Buying Guide for the Best Mini Split Ac For Rv

Choosing the right mini-split AC for your RV is crucial for ensuring comfort during your travels. Mini-split ACs are known for their efficiency and ability to cool specific areas without the need for extensive ductwork. When selecting a mini-split AC for your RV, consider the size of your RV, your typical travel destinations, and your personal comfort preferences. Here are some key specifications to consider and how to navigate them to find the best fit for your needs.
BTU RatingBTU (British Thermal Unit) rating measures the cooling capacity of the AC. This spec is important because it determines how effectively the unit can cool your RV. For small RVs, a unit with 9,000 to 12,000 BTUs may be sufficient. Medium-sized RVs might require 12,000 to 18,000 BTUs, while larger RVs could need 18,000 to 24,000 BTUs or more. To pick the right one, consider the size of your RV and the typical climate of your travel destinations. A higher BTU rating is better for larger spaces and hotter climates.
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ER)The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ER) measures the efficiency of the AC unit. It is calculated by dividing the BTU rating by the power consumption in watts. A higher EER indicates a more efficient unit, which is important for reducing energy consumption and saving on electricity costs. EER values typically range from 8 to 12. For RVs, an EER of 10 or higher is generally recommended to ensure good energy efficiency. Choose a unit with a higher EER if you plan to use the AC frequently or if you want to minimize your energy usage.
Noise LevelNoise level is measured in decibels (dB) and indicates how loud the AC unit will be when operating. This spec is important for maintaining a comfortable and quiet environment inside your RV. Noise levels for mini-split ACs typically range from 30 to 50 dB. For a quieter experience, look for units with noise levels below 40 dB. If you are sensitive to noise or plan to use the AC while sleeping, prioritize a unit with a lower noise level.
Installation and MaintenanceInstallation and maintenance refer to the ease of setting up and maintaining the AC unit. This spec is important because a unit that is difficult to install or maintain can lead to additional costs and inconvenience. Some mini-split ACs come with DIY installation kits, while others may require professional installation. Consider your technical skills and willingness to perform maintenance tasks. If you prefer a hassle-free experience, choose a unit with straightforward installation instructions and minimal maintenance requirements.
Heating CapabilitySome mini-split AC units also offer heating capabilities, making them versatile for year-round use. This spec is important if you plan to use your RV in colder climates or during the winter months. Heating capabilities are usually measured in BTUs, similar to cooling capacity. If you need both cooling and heating, look for a unit that offers a heat pump function with adequate BTU ratings for both heating and cooling. This can provide added comfort and convenience during your travels.
Remote Control and Smart FeaturesRemote control and smart features allow you to operate the AC unit conveniently. This spec is important for ease of use and enhancing your overall experience. Some units come with remote controls, while others may offer smart features like Wi-Fi connectivity, allowing you to control the AC via a smartphone app. If you value convenience and modern technology, look for units with these features. They can make it easier to adjust settings and monitor the AC's performance from anywhere in your RV.
